Kohli storm rages

PERTH – No one in this country is talking about the quick pitch at the WACA ahead of the big West Indies and India showdown.

No one in India is discussing their country’s recent superior record against the West Indies, but the cricketing headlines all over are about Virat Kohli’s abusive behaviour to a journalist on the eve of their clash tomorrow in the ICC Cricket World Cup.

The unbeaten Indians face the nervy West Indians in a match that could well determine the regional team’s future in the tournament, but the distraction from Kohli’s outburst at the Murdoch University, where the teams practised on Tuesday has dominated everyone’s attention and caused the Board for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) to step in.
